The transport market is on the verge of a major change sustained by self-operating automobiles like drones and self-governing trucks. These developments are set to change the means items are moved and brought to their destinations, causing substantial benefits in addition to posing numerous barriers that require to be fixed.

The Change Through Autonomous Autos

Autonomous transport modern technology is poised to transform the area of boosting the speed, effectiveness, and financial feasibility of moving products. Driverless vehicles can function continuously without breaks, leading to remarkable reductions in delivery periods. Alternatively, drones offer quick delivery alternatives that are particularly advantageous in city setups for covering brief distances.

Benefits of Autonomous Autos in Logistics

1. By taking on self-governing cars, firms can substantially decrease their logistics expenses by lessening labor-related costs. With a lowered requirement for human chauffeurs, organizations can designate fewer sources towards staff member payment, benefits, and training programs. In addition, the continuous operation of automobiles around the clock makes it possible for business to maximize their possession productivity and obtain the most out of their fleet.
2. Increased Effectiveness: Autonomous lorries can enhance courses in real-time, preventing traffic congestion and minimizing fuel intake. This not only lowers functional costs yet also decreases the environmental influence. Drones can bypass roadway traffic entirely, providing a swift and reliable delivery approach.
3. Enhanced Safety and security: Human error is a leading root cause of accidents in logistics. Independent vehicles, outfitted with advanced sensing units and AI, can significantly minimize the risk of crashes. They can maintain constant speeds, stick strictly to web traffic regulations, and react to threats faster than human vehicle drivers.
4. Scalability: The scalability of logistics procedures is greatly improved with independent cars. Firms can easily broaden their fleets without the constraints imposed by personnels. This is specifically advantageous throughout peak seasons when demand rises.

Challenges Dealing With Autonomous Autos in Logistics

1. Regulatory Obstacles: The governing landscape for autonomous cars is still advancing. Different countries and areas have differing laws and guidelines, developing a complex atmosphere for firms operating globally. Attaining conformity and acquiring authorization for autonomous operations can be lengthy and pricey.
2. Safety Issues: While independent vehicles promise improved safety and security, they are not foolproof. Technical malfunctions, cyberattacks, and unexpected challenges posture significant risks. Guaranteeing the integrity and protection of these systems is paramount, needing extensive screening and durable cybersecurity measures.
3. Technical Limitations: The modern technology behind independent vehicles, though advanced, is not yet best. Sensing units can be influenced by damaging weather conditions, and complex urban atmospheres present navigating obstacles. Continual renovation and innovation are necessary to deal with these restrictions.
4. Prevalent fostering of self-driving autos rests on obtaining the trust fund of both the public and sector specialists. To conquer this difficulty, it's vital to honestly resolve and relieve problems bordering work variation, safety and security, and system reliability with clear interaction, education and learning, and presentations that showcase the advantages and credibility of self-governing technology.
